I’m a Tenured Scientist at the Institut de Robòtica i Informàtica Industrial (IRII).
My research focuses on designing social robots that can adapt to and proactively anticipate a user’s individual needs in assistive contexts. To achieve this, I investigate methods for personalisation, Theory of Mind and explainable AI, ensuring robots are transparent partners that foster trust in long-term interactions.
